Re: “Let’s raise the bar for who we allow to become new Canadians,” Daphne Bramham, Opinion, May 20.
New Canadians expect you to refrain from stereotyping and generalizing when you see us sporting a full-size beard, or when you see our women wearing hijabs. We are not terrorists or radicalized persons. We believe that Canada is a democratic country and no one should dictate to us what we should wear or not wear.
We expect you not to generalize when you see images in the media promoting Islamophobia. New Canadians are proud and take their citizenship seriously and are loyal to the country.
We expect municipal, provincial and federal politicians of all stripes to talk to us all the time, and not woo us only during elections.
